Possible Causes of Smoke Stains on Ceilings
Smoke stains on ceilings are often the result of fire incidents, whether from household fires, electrical faults, or kitchen accidents. When a fire occurs, smoke rises and adheres to surfaces, leaving behind stubborn soot and discoloration. Even minor smoke exposure can cause noticeable staining that requires professional attention to restore the appearance of your ceilings.
Another common cause of smoke staining is prolonged cigarette or cigar smoke in indoor spaces. Over time, this consistent exposure can result in a layer of soot and tar buildup on ceilings, creating unsightly marks that diminish the aesthetic appeal of your home. In some cases, faulty heating systems or fireplaces can also contribute to smoke buildup and staining on ceilings and walls.

Can smoke stains be completely removed from ceilings?
Yes, in most cases, smoke stains can be effectively removed with professional cleaning and mitigation techniques. Severe damage or longstanding stains may require repainting or sealing to achieve the best results.

Will I need to repaint my ceiling after removal?
Sometimes, a fresh coat of paint or stain-blocking primer is recommended to prevent future staining and to restore a uniform appearance. Our experts can advise you on the best course of action.
